Appliance Setup

A. Fixed Glass Assembly
WARNING! Risk of Asphyxiation! Handle fi xed glass
assembly with care. Inspect the gasket to ensure it is
undamaged and inspect the glass for cracks, chips or
scratches.
• DO NOT strike, slam or scratch glass.
• DO NOT operate fi replace with glass removed, cracked,
broken or scratched.
• Replace as a complete assembly.
Removing Fixed Glass Assembly
1. Remove the decorative front from fi replace and set
aside on work surface.
2. Locate the glass latches that are on the upper edge of
the glass frame of the appliance. See Figure 11.1.
3. Use both index fi ngers to release the glass clips.
4. Allow glass to tilt forward. Grasp glass on the upper
return lip of glass frame and lift up and out. The glass
should lift easily out of the bottom retaining lip.
Replacing Fixed Glass Assembly
1. Locate retaining lip on lower front face of fi rebox.
2. Place glass assembly into retaining lip end. Tilt top of
glass assembly toward fi replace.
3. Assure proper left to right placement of glass and en-
gage all four spring latches.
GLASS CLIPS
BOTTOM RETAINING LIP
Figure 11.1 Fixed Glass Assembly
B. Remove the Shipping Materials
Remove shipping materials from inside or underneath
the fi rebox. Verify all components are with the fi replace.

C. Clean the Appliance
Clean/vacuum any sawdust that may have accumulated
inside the fi rebox or underneath in the control cavity.
D. Install Media
A media kit is included with the CRAVE models. Install
rock media according to these instructions.
WARNING! Choking Hazard! Keep media out of reach
of children.
CAUTION! Risk of Burns! The fi replace should be turned
off and cooled before media is installed.
CAUTION! Risk of Cuts, Abrasions or Flying Debris.
Wear protective gloves and safety glasses during instal-
lation. Sheet metal edges are sharp.
Cleaning the Media
During shipment of the media, dust and debris can
accumulate. It is recommended that the media be rinsed
thoroughly with water to remove dust and small particles.
An easy method to clean the media is to place the media
into a pail and rinse thoroughly. Spread the media out
over paper towels and allow the media to dry before
installing them into the fi replace.
INSTALLATION
1. Choose 7 - 10 round pieces of media approximately
1/2 inch in size and set them aside. These will be used
later to conceal the pilot end of the burner. Reference
Figure 1 for choosing round pieces of glass.
WARNING! Risk of Explosion! DO NOT put any fl at
media pieces larger than 1/2 inch in diameter near pilot.
Delayed ignition could occur. Use only round 1/2 inch
pieces near pilot.
